use super::TxTester;
impl TxTester {
/// ## Testing methods for validity range
///
/// Checks if the transaction is valid after a specified timestamp.
pub fn valid_after(&mut self, required_timestamp: u64) -> &mut Self {
let invalid_before =
if let Some(validity_range) = &self.tx_body.validity_range.invalid_hereafter {
*validity_range
} else {
9999_999_999_999 // A very large number representing "no limit"
};
let is_valid_after =
if let Some(validity_range) = &self.tx_body.validity_range.invalid_before {
*validity_range < required_timestamp
} else {
true
};
if !is_valid_after {
self.add_trace(
"valid_after",
&format!(
"tx invalid before {}, with required_timestamp {}",
invalid_before, required_timestamp
),
);
}
self
}
/// ## Testing methods for validity range
///
/// Checks if the transaction is valid before a specified timestamp.
pub fn valid_before(&mut self, required_timestamp: u64) -> &mut Self {
let invalid_hereafter =
if let Some(validity_range) = &self.tx_body.validity_range.invalid_before {
*validity_range
} else {
0 // Representing "no limit"
};
let is_valid_before =
if let Some(validity_range) = &self.tx_body.validity_range.invalid_hereafter {
*validity_range > required_timestamp
} else {
true
};
if !is_valid_before {
self.add_trace(
"valid_before",
&format!(
"tx invalid after {}, with required_timestamp {}",
invalid_hereafter, required_timestamp
),
);
}
self
}
}
